AT&T Stadium Parking

There are roughly 12,000 parking spaces spread out across the AT&T Stadium’s 15 numbered lots. In addition, there are nearly 12,000 parking spots in car parks around the Texas Rangers Ballpark that can be used by stadium-goers on an event day. Parking is usually open five hours before a Stadium event.
Once a visitor enters their lot, they will be assisted to an available parking spot by a member of staff. A parking pass is valid for 1 space. In order to park close to the vehicle of another party, please ensure both parties have parking passes for the same lot and arrive together, otherwise parking spaces in close proximity cannot be guaranteed.

Parking Lot Hours and Access
Parking lots generally open five hours before Dallas Cowboys games and at varying times before other events. For stadium tours and non-event days, parking in Lots 6 and 7 is free as of January 2025. All vehicles entering the secured parking perimeter face security inspections before being allowed to park.
You should purchase parking passes in advance whenever possible rather than paying cash at the gate. Pre-purchased passes guarantee you a designated lot and often cost less than game-day prices. Season ticket holders can purchase season parking passes for designated lots, ensuring consistent parking for each home game.
Parking Costs and Lot Options
Parking costs vary significantly by event type and lot location. Blue Lots on the south side typically cost $30 for general admission games and $40 for premium matchups. Silver Lots positioned on the north side near Globe Life Field charge $25 for general games and $35 for premium events.
Pre-sold and cash lots provide more budget-friendly options at $20 for pre-purchased passes and $25 for cash payment. For concerts and special events, parking prices fluctuate with demand and can range from $35 to over $90, depending on the artist or event.
Accessible and Specialty Parking
Accessible parking spaces are available in each parking lot on a first-come, first-served basis. You must display a valid state-issued disabled person license plate or placard to park in accessible spaces. Courtesy shuttle carts serve each lot to provide transportation for guests with limited mobility.
A portion of Lot 14 specifically designates spaces for RVs and oversized vehicles, with proper parking passes. Bus parking is available in the designated portion of Lot 15. Groups arriving by bus must purchase bus parking passes in advance.
Alternative Transportation Options
Passenger drop-off zones provide convenient options if someone is driving you to the event. For rideshare pickup after events, make your way to Lot 15 off Randol Mill Road and Web Street, where designated rideshare zones help organize the process.
Several nearby restaurants and bars, including J. Gilligan’s Bar & Grill, offer shuttle services to and from AT&T Stadium for a fee. Some hotels near the stadium also provide shuttle services for their guests. The Arlington Trolley system provides public transportation access to the stadium from various locations throughout the city.
Tailgating Guidelines
Tailgating is a beloved tradition at Cowboys games, and AT&T Stadium accommodates it in designated areas. Specific lots permit tailgating, allowing you to set up grills, chairs, and tents in your parking space. Rules require that all tailgating equipment stay within your designated parking area. Drive aisles must remain clear at all times for emergency vehicle access.
